How are summer monsoons different from winter monsoons?

summer monsoons come from the direction of the ocean so they bring moisture and make farming easier. winter monsoons come from the north and bring dry air, making farming hard.

How are summer monsoons and winter monsoons alike?

Summer monsoons and winter monsoons are both driven by the temperature difference between land and water, which causes a change in wind direction and brings heavy rainfall to certain regions. Both types of monsoons are important for replenishing water resources and supporting agriculture in affected areas.

Which way do winter monsoons blow?

Winter monsoons blow from land to sea. In the Northern Hemisphere, they typically move from northeast to southwest, while in the Southern Hemisphere they move from southeast to northwest. These monsoons bring cold, dry air from the continents to the surrounding oceans.

Where do the summer monsoons pick up water?

Summer monsoons originate in the Southern seas or oceans. The water in the ocean is warm, therefore it evaporates a lot. This in conclusion creates heavy moisture content.
